Wed, 02 Jan 2013 19:59:06 +0100 |
blanchet |
generate "obtain" steps corresponding to skolemization inferences
|
file |
diff |
annotate
|
Wed, 02 Jan 2013 16:32:40 +0100 |
blanchet |
keep E's and Vampire's skolemization steps
|
file |
diff |
annotate
|
Wed, 02 Jan 2013 16:02:33 +0100 |
blanchet |
tuning
|
file |
diff |
annotate
|
Wed, 02 Jan 2013 15:54:38 +0100 |
blanchet |
fixed oversensitive Skolem handling (cf. eaa540986291)
|
file |
diff |
annotate
|
Wed, 02 Jan 2013 15:44:00 +0100 |
blanchet |
added "obtain" to Isar proof construction data structure
|
file |
diff |
annotate
|
Wed, 02 Jan 2013 13:31:13 +0100 |
blanchet |
tuning
|
file |
diff |
annotate
|
Wed, 02 Jan 2013 13:14:47 +0100 |
blanchet |
properly take the existential closure of skolems
|
file |
diff |
annotate
|
Sat, 15 Dec 2012 19:57:12 +0100 |
blanchet |
thread no timeout properly
|
file |
diff |
annotate
|
Mon, 10 Dec 2012 13:52:33 +0100 |
wenzelm |
generalized notion of active area, where sendback is just one application;
|
file |
diff |
annotate
|
Thu, 06 Dec 2012 23:01:49 +0100 |
wenzelm |
proper Sendback.markup, as required for standard Prover IDE protocol (see also c62ce309dc26);
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:43 +0100 |
smolkas |
tweaked calculation of sledgehammer messages
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:43 +0100 |
smolkas |
adapted sledgehammer warnings
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:43 +0100 |
smolkas |
fixed preplaying of case splits; incorperated new name of structure: Isabelle_Markup -> Markup
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:43 +0100 |
smolkas |
added warning when shrinking proof without preplaying
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:43 +0100 |
smolkas |
deal with the case that metis does not time out, but fails instead
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:43 +0100 |
smolkas |
renaming, minor tweaks, added signature
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:43 +0100 |
smolkas |
moved thms_of_name to Sledgehammer_Util and removed copies, updated references
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:43 +0100 |
smolkas |
removed duplicate decleration
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:43 +0100 |
smolkas |
renamed sledgehammer_isar_reconstruct to sledgehammer_proof
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:43 +0100 |
smolkas |
fixed problem with fact names
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:25:06 +0100 |
smolkas |
remove hack and generalize code slightly
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:23:44 +0100 |
smolkas |
simplified isar_qualifiers and qs merging
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:22:17 +0100 |
smolkas |
put shrink in own structure
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:22:05 +0100 |
smolkas |
put annotate in own structure
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:21:42 +0100 |
smolkas |
support assumptions as facts for preplaying
|
file |
diff |
annotate
|
Wed, 28 Nov 2012 12:20:06 +0100 |
smolkas |
some minor improvements in shrink_proof
|
file |
diff |
annotate
|
Mon, 26 Nov 2012 21:46:04 +0100 |
wenzelm |
tuned signature;
|
file |
diff |
annotate
|
Mon, 26 Nov 2012 11:45:12 +0100 |
blanchet |
distinguish declated tfrees from other tfrees -- only the later can be optimized away
|
file |
diff |
annotate
|
Thu, 22 Nov 2012 13:21:02 +0100 |
wenzelm |
more abstract Sendback operations, with explicit id/exec_id properties;
|
file |
diff |
annotate
|
Fri, 16 Nov 2012 16:59:56 +0100 |
wenzelm |
made SML/NJ happy;
|
file |
diff |
annotate
|
Mon, 12 Nov 2012 12:06:56 +0100 |
blanchet |
avoid messing too much with output of "string_of_term", so that it doesn't break the yxml encoding for jEdit
|
file |
diff |
annotate
|
Mon, 12 Nov 2012 11:52:37 +0100 |
blanchet |
centralized term printing code
|
file |
diff |
annotate
|
Tue, 06 Nov 2012 15:15:33 +0100 |
blanchet |
renamed Sledgehammer option
|
file |
diff |
annotate
|
Tue, 06 Nov 2012 15:12:31 +0100 |
blanchet |
always show timing for structured proofs
|
file |
diff |
annotate
|
Tue, 06 Nov 2012 14:46:21 +0100 |
blanchet |
use implications rather than disjunctions to improve readability
|
file |
diff |
annotate
|
Tue, 06 Nov 2012 13:47:51 +0100 |
blanchet |
avoid name clashes
|
file |
diff |
annotate
|
Tue, 06 Nov 2012 13:09:02 +0100 |
blanchet |
fixed more "Trueprop" issues
|
file |
diff |
annotate
|
Tue, 06 Nov 2012 12:38:45 +0100 |
blanchet |
removed needless sort
|
file |
diff |
annotate
|
Tue, 06 Nov 2012 11:24:48 +0100 |
blanchet |
avoid double "Trueprop"s
|
file |
diff |
annotate
|
Tue, 06 Nov 2012 11:20:56 +0100 |
blanchet |
use original formulas for hypotheses and conclusion to avoid mismatches
|
file |
diff |
annotate
|
Tue, 06 Nov 2012 11:20:56 +0100 |
blanchet |
track formula roles in proofs and use that to determine whether the conjecture should be negated or not
|
file |
diff |
annotate
|
Tue, 06 Nov 2012 11:20:56 +0100 |
blanchet |
proper handling of assumptions arising from the goal's being expressed in rule format, for Isar proof construction
|
file |
diff |
annotate
|
Fri, 02 Nov 2012 16:16:48 +0100 |
blanchet |
handle non-unit clauses gracefully
|
file |
diff |
annotate
|
Fri, 02 Nov 2012 16:16:48 +0100 |
blanchet |
several improvements to Isar proof reconstruction, by Steffen Smolka (step merging in case splits, time measurements, etc.)
|
file |
diff |
annotate
|
Wed, 31 Oct 2012 11:23:21 +0100 |
blanchet |
fixed bool vs. prop mismatch
|
file |
diff |
annotate
|
Wed, 31 Oct 2012 11:23:21 +0100 |
blanchet |
took out "using only ..." comments in Sledgehammer generated metis/smt calls, until these can be generated soundly
|
file |
diff |
annotate
|
Wed, 31 Oct 2012 11:23:21 +0100 |
blanchet |
use metaquantification when possible in Isar proofs
|
file |
diff |
annotate
|
Wed, 31 Oct 2012 11:23:21 +0100 |
blanchet |
tuning
|
file |
diff |
annotate
|
Fri, 19 Oct 2012 17:52:21 +0200 |
wenzelm |
made SML/NJ happy;
|
file |
diff |
annotate
|
Thu, 18 Oct 2012 15:41:15 +0200 |
blanchet |
tuned Isar output
|
file |
diff |
annotate
|
Thu, 18 Oct 2012 15:05:17 +0200 |
blanchet |
renamed Isar-proof related options + changed semantics of Isar shrinking
|
file |
diff |
annotate
|
Thu, 18 Oct 2012 14:26:45 +0200 |
blanchet |
tuning
|
file |
diff |
annotate
|
Thu, 18 Oct 2012 13:46:24 +0200 |
blanchet |
fixed theorem lookup code in Isar proof reconstruction
|
file |
diff |
annotate
|
Thu, 18 Oct 2012 13:37:53 +0200 |
blanchet |
tuning
|
file |
diff |
annotate
|
Thu, 18 Oct 2012 13:19:44 +0200 |
blanchet |
refactor code
|
file |
diff |
annotate
|
Thu, 18 Oct 2012 11:59:45 +0200 |
blanchet |
tuning
|
file |
diff |
annotate
|
Tue, 16 Oct 2012 20:31:08 +0200 |
blanchet |
added missing file
|
file |
diff |
annotate
|
Fri, 22 Oct 2010 12:15:31 +0200 |
blanchet |
got rid of duplicate functionality ("run_smt_solver_somehow");
|
file |
diff |
annotate
|
Thu, 21 Oct 2010 16:25:40 +0200 |
blanchet |
first step in adding support for an SMT backend to Sledgehammer
|
file |
diff |
annotate
|
Tue, 05 Oct 2010 11:45:10 +0200 |
blanchet |
hide uninteresting MESON/Metis constants and facts and remove "meson_" prefix to (now hidden) fact names
|
file |
diff |
annotate
|
Sat, 25 Sep 2010 10:32:14 +0200 |
blanchet |
make SML/NJ happy
|
file |
diff |
annotate
|
Fri, 17 Sep 2010 01:22:01 +0200 |
blanchet |
move functions around
|
file |
diff |
annotate
|
Thu, 16 Sep 2010 16:24:23 +0200 |
blanchet |
added new "Metis_Reconstruct" module, temporarily empty
|
file |
diff |
annotate
|
Thu, 16 Sep 2010 16:12:02 +0200 |
blanchet |
rename "Metis_Clauses" to "Metis_Translate" for consistency with "Sledgehammer_Translate"
|
file |
diff |
annotate
|
Thu, 16 Sep 2010 15:38:46 +0200 |
blanchet |
move SPASS's Flotter hack to "Sledgehammer_Reconstruct"
|
file |
diff |
annotate
|
Thu, 16 Sep 2010 13:52:17 +0200 |
blanchet |
merge constructors
|
file |
diff |
annotate
|
Thu, 16 Sep 2010 13:44:41 +0200 |
blanchet |
factor out the inverse of "nice_atp_problem"
|
file |
diff |
annotate
|
Thu, 16 Sep 2010 11:59:45 +0200 |
blanchet |
use the same TSTP/Vampire/SPASS parser for one-liners as for Isar proofs
|
file |
diff |
annotate
|
Thu, 16 Sep 2010 11:12:08 +0200 |
blanchet |
factored out TSTP/SPASS/Vampire proof parsing;
|
file |
diff |
annotate
|
Wed, 15 Sep 2010 18:27:29 +0200 |
blanchet |
fix parsing of higher-order formulas;
|
file |
diff |
annotate
|
Tue, 14 Sep 2010 23:36:23 +0200 |
blanchet |
fix splitting of proof lines for one-line metis calls;
|
file |
diff |
annotate
|
Tue, 14 Sep 2010 23:01:29 +0200 |
blanchet |
finish support for E 1.2 proof reconstruction;
|
file |
diff |
annotate
|
Tue, 14 Sep 2010 20:07:18 +0200 |
blanchet |
first step in generalizing to nonnumeric proof step names (e.g. remote Vampire 0.6)
|
file |
diff |
annotate
|
Tue, 14 Sep 2010 19:38:44 +0200 |
blanchet |
use same hack as in "Async_Manager" to work around Proof General bug
|
file |
diff |
annotate
|
Tue, 14 Sep 2010 17:36:27 +0200 |
blanchet |
generalize proof reconstruction code;
|
file |
diff |
annotate
|
Mon, 13 Sep 2010 21:24:10 +0200 |
blanchet |
merged
|
file |
diff |
annotate
|
Sat, 11 Sep 2010 12:31:42 +0200 |
blanchet |
tuning
|
file |
diff |
annotate
|
Sun, 12 Sep 2010 19:04:02 +0200 |
wenzelm |
eliminated aliases of Type.constraint;
|
file |
diff |
annotate
|
Sun, 05 Sep 2010 21:41:24 +0200 |
wenzelm |
turned show_sorts/show_types into proper configuration options;
|
file |
diff |
annotate
|
Fri, 03 Sep 2010 15:54:03 +0200 |
wenzelm |
turned show_no_free_types into proper configuration option show_free_types, with flipped polarity;
|
file |
diff |
annotate
|
Thu, 02 Sep 2010 22:02:48 +0200 |
blanchet |
fix trivial "x = x" fact detection
|
file |
diff |
annotate
|
Tue, 31 Aug 2010 23:50:59 +0200 |
blanchet |
finished renaming
|
file |
diff |
annotate
|
Tue, 31 Aug 2010 23:46:23 +0200 |
blanchet |
shorten a few file names
|
file |
diff |
annotate
| base
|